In July of 1999 I graduated from Cheltenham and Gloucester college of Higher education, having attained a BA (Hons) degree in Fine Art, Printmaking (2:1).

I have had a strong interest in the world of art and design from a very young age, especially in the field of printmaking. I believe that when someone shows a talent for anything it should be nurtured and encouraged. I studied Art with intrigue throughout my secondary education and when the opportunity arose for me to study it full-time, through the national diploma, I relished it. It was at this time that I developed a keen interest specifically in printmaking, which eventually led to my chosen degree path at Cheltenham and Gloucester.

At Cheltenham I was introduced to and trained in the many aspects of Printmaking, from etching to lithography and silkscreen. It was also at this that I first became fully aware of the Internet and it's unlimited possibilities. My interest in photography and computer aided design combined with the silkscreen process, and use of the Internet, has led to many successful pieces, some of which can be viewed on this site.
